David Hasselhoff has reportedly been awarded full custody of his two children.

The outcome comes just weeks after one of the "Baywatch" star's daughter filmed her father intoxicated, laying on a floor and eating a hamburger. A Los Angeles Superior Court has ruled that recovering alcoholic David is a fitter parent than his ex-wife, Pamela Bach.

The former couple have been in the process of a messy divorce and a fight for custody over their two teenage daughters. According to TMZ, a psychological evaluation on the Hasselhoff family determined that David is the better choice to parent.

The celebrity website also reported that The Hoff's case revolved around claims that Pamela was physically abusive to her children, especially youngest child Hayley.

The actor's lawyer, Melvin Goldsman, told Access Hollywood that the star was "very happy the truth came out today."

Pamela was represented by Debra Opri, the same attorney who defended Larry Birkhead during his paternity case.

According to Hollyscoop, there will be another hearing in two weeks to finalise the custody decision.
